Demand for personal mobility and the anti-China sentiment will be key factors in the growth of India's helmet industry, says Siddharth Bhushan Khurana, MD of Studds Accessories, a leading wholesale manufacturer and exporter of helmets and motorcycle accessories. "People do not want to use public transport and they are moving towards two-wheelers. We are also seeing a big uptick in demand for used two-wheelers. Both markets are driving growth for the helmet industry," he said. The helmet industry in India has been growing at a rate of approximately 25 percent annually and now Khurana expects a 30-35 percent annual growth rate over the next few years. With companies wanting to establish alternate supply chains, Studds India has started receiving inquiries from markets where it has no presence yet.
